Independent study: Softeners among household energy savers
Published By: Water Quality Association
Published On: 2010-04-14

Lesle, Water softeners can save significant amounts of money and energy in the home, a major new study by the independent Battelle Institute reavealed.

Softeners help preserve the efficiency of water heaters and major appliances and keep showers and faucets unclogged, the report found. The study was commissioned by the Water Quality Research Foundation (WQRF) in 2009. Battelle Memorial Institute is a renowned independent testing and research facility dedicated to applied science and techn...

Studies show washing with softened water can significantly cut detergent use, energy consumption
Published By: Water Quality Association   (Link to Article)
Published On: 2011-03-02

Lisle, Illinois Consumers can cut back on dish and laundry detergent use by 50 percent or more and lower washing machine temperatures from hot to cold just by using softened water, as shown by two new independent studies that were recently released.
